👀 SPOILER-FREE SUMMARY
The series finale of Darling in the FranXX splits its emotional energy between two very different scales. On one front, expect sweeping cosmic confrontation with everything on the line. On the other, something quieter and more grounded — the slow, difficult work of rebuilding and finding meaning after the world has fundamentally changed. The episode carries the weight of a full 24-episode journey, leaning heavily into themes of sacrifice, legacy, and what it means to truly live. The pacing oscillates between urgent, high-stakes momentum and reflective, bittersweet stillness. Hiro and Zero Two's bond reaches its ultimate expression, while Squad 13's remaining members face the future they've inherited. Whether the landing works for you will depend on how invested you are in these characters beyond the mecha spectacle. Bring tissues either way.

📍 ARC CONTEXT
As the final episode in a 24-episode run, this directly follows Episode 23's dramatic departure of Hiro and Zero Two toward VIRM space, resolving both their personal arc and humanity's broader fate in a single conclusion. The episode serves as the payoff for every relationship thread, thematic question, and world-building element the series has built since Episode 1 — from the early days of Plantation 13 through the VIRM revelation. There is nothing after this; it's the definitive ending, tasked with closing out every major character arc simultaneously.
